What is a Bill of Sale?

A bill of sale is a legal document that outlines the transfer of ownership of a vehicle from one party to another. It typically includes details such as the vehicle’s make, model, year, VIN (Vehicle Identification Number), the purchase price, and the names and addresses of both the buyer and seller. While it may seem like a mere formality, this document plays a vital role in ensuring that the transaction is legitimate and accepted by law.

Why You Need a Bill of Sale

Having a bill of sale provides several important benefits:

  • Proof of Purchase: It serves as proof that you purchased the vehicle, which can be important for registration and insurance purposes.
  • Record Keeping: It helps maintain an accurate record of the transaction, which can be helpful if disputes arise later.
  • Legal Protection: A bill of sale can protect you from potential claims by the seller or issues related to vehicle liens.
  • Tax Documentation: It helps in documenting the sale price for tax purposes, which is often required by state authorities.

What to Include in a Bill of Sale

To ensure your bill of sale is effective, it should contain specific information. Here’s what you should always include:

  • Names and addresses of both the buyer and seller
  • Vehicle description (make, model, year, VIN)
  • Purchase price and payment method
  • Date of sale
  • Signatures of both parties

In some cases, it may also be wise to include a statement regarding the vehicle’s condition or warranties if applicable. This can further clarify expectations and protect both parties involved.

Common Pitfalls to Avoid

While drafting or signing a bill of sale, there are several pitfalls to watch for:

  • Missing Information: Ensure all required details are present. Incomplete documents can lead to disputes.
  • Not Keeping Copies: Always keep a signed copy for your records. Digital copies can serve as backups.
  • Ignoring State Requirements: Different states have specific rules regarding bills of sale. Make sure to comply with local regulations.

By avoiding these common mistakes, you can make the process smoother and ensure that your rights are protected.

State-Specific Considerations

Different states have varying requirements for vehicle transactions. Some may require notarization, while others may need specific information included in the bill of sale. Familiarizing yourself with your state’s laws is critical. Neglecting these details can lead to complications during registration or when selling the vehicle in the future.

Final Steps After the Sale

Once the transaction is complete, there are several steps you should take to finalize the process:

  • Transfer the title to the new owner.
  • File any required paperwork with your local DMV.
  • Notify your insurance company of the sale.
  • Keep all related documents together for future reference.

These actions ensure that both parties are legally protected and that the vehicle is registered correctly under the new owner’s name. Missing even one step can lead to legal trouble or unexpected fees.
